This zucchini bread recipe is the perfect way to use up summer zucchini—moist, sweet, and irresistibly spiced. It’s the kind of treat that feels like a cozy hug, whether you’re enjoying it with your morning coffee or sneaking a slice as a late-night snack.
I first made this on a rainy afternoon when I had two lonely zucchinis in the fridge and a craving for something comforting. What came out of the oven was pure magic: golden-brown edges, a soft center, and just the right balance of cinnamon warmth and natural sweetness.
The best part? It’s incredibly simple. No fancy mixers, no hard-to-find ingredients—just one bowl, a handful of pantry staples, and about an hour from start to finish. Whether you’re a first-time baker or a seasoned pro, this zucchini bread is easy to master, endlessly adaptable, and guaranteed to become a household favorite.
Why You’ll Love This Recipe
Moist, Sweet, and Lightly Spiced
Let’s be honest—no one wants dry zucchini bread. And this one? It’s the exact opposite. Thanks to the freshly grated zucchini, every slice is incredibly moist and tender, with just the right amount of natural sweetness.
Then comes the warm spice. A generous sprinkle of cinnamon and a hint of nutmeg add that comforting, almost nostalgic flavor that makes you want to go back for just one more slice.
And if you’re someone who likes a little something extra, this recipe welcomes add-ins with open arms. Toss in some chopped walnuts for crunch, or swirl in dark chocolate chips for an indulgent twist. Every version turns out delicious.
Simple, Pantry-Friendly Ingredients
This zucchini bread keeps things refreshingly simple. No obscure ingredients. No trips to specialty stores.
You’ll find everything you need already sitting in your pantry and fridge:
-
Basic flours (all-purpose and a touch of whole wheat for heartiness)
-
Baking staples like eggs, sugar, oil, and vanilla
-
A couple of cozy spices you probably already have
The best part? You don’t need a stand mixer or fancy gadgets—just a couple of bowls, a whisk, and maybe a box grater for the zucchini.
Foolproof and Beginner-Friendly
If baking ever felt intimidating, this recipe is your new best friend. It’s genuinely hard to mess up.
Here’s why:
-
It all comes together in one bowl. Less mess, less fuss.
-
No mixer needed—a simple whisk or spoon does the job beautifully.
-
Perfect for involving kids or beginner bakers who want to feel like pros.
Whether it’s your first time making quick bread or your hundredth, this recipe delivers consistent, tasty results every time.
Flexible and Customizable
This zucchini bread recipe is like a blank canvas—easy to adapt to your preferences or what’s in your pantry.
Want it healthier? Use coconut oil or swap in a portion of whole wheat flour.
Need a gluten-free version? A 1:1 gluten-free flour blend works like a charm.
No nuts in the house? Skip them or replace with seeds or coconut.
Here are a few more ways to make it your own:
-
Add lemon zest for brightness
-
Use shredded carrot alongside the zucchini
-
Turn it into muffins or mini loaves for perfect snack-size portions
Ingredients
Full List of Ingredients
You don’t need a long shopping list to make something delicious. This zucchini bread is built from simple ingredients—many of which you probably already have on hand. Here’s what you’ll need, along with a quick note on why each one matters:
-
2 cups grated zucchini – The star of the show! It brings natural moisture and helps keep the bread soft and tender.
-
1½ cups all-purpose flour – Gives the bread its structure and classic crumb.
-
½ cup whole wheat flour – Adds a slightly nutty flavor and a bit more fiber.
-
1 tsp baking powder – Helps the loaf rise beautifully.
-
½ tsp baking soda – Reacts with the zucchini’s natural acidity for lift.
-
½ tsp salt – Enhances flavor and balances the sweetness.
-
2 tsp ground cinnamon – Brings cozy, spiced warmth to every bite.
-
½ tsp ground nutmeg – Subtle and comforting, like autumn in a pinch.
-
2 large eggs – They hold everything together and add richness.
-
½ cup olive oil or melted coconut oil – Adds moisture and a tender crumb.
-
¾ cup cane sugar or brown sugar – Sweetens the bread and adds a hint of caramel.
-
1 tsp vanilla extract – Rounds out the flavor and gives it a warm aroma.
-
½ cup chopped walnuts or pecans (optional) – For crunch and a nutty bite.
-
½ cup dark chocolate chips (optional) – Because why not add a little indulgence?
How to Make Zucchini Bread
Step-by-Step Instructions
This is the kind of recipe you’ll find yourself coming back to over and over again—not just because it’s delicious, but because it’s so doable. Let’s walk through it, step by step:
-
Preheat your oven to 350°F (175°C). Lightly grease a 9×5-inch loaf pan and line it with parchment paper for easy removal.
-
Grate the zucchini using a box grater. Don’t peel it! Then, place the grated zucchini in a clean kitchen towel and squeeze out as much water as possible—this helps prevent a soggy loaf.
-
In a medium bowl, whisk together the flours, baking powder, baking soda, salt, cinnamon, and nutmeg.
-
In a large bowl, mix the eggs, oil, sugar, and vanilla until smooth and well combined.
-
Fold the zucchini into the wet mixture.
-
Gradually add the dry ingredients to the wet ingredients. Stir just until combined—don’t overmix, or the bread may turn out dense.
-
If using, gently fold in the nuts or chocolate chips.
-
Pour the batter into your prepared pan and smooth out the top.
-
Bake for 50–60 minutes, or until a toothpick inserted into the center comes out clean (a few moist crumbs are fine!).
-
Let the bread cool in the pan for 10 minutes, then carefully transfer it to a wire rack to cool completely.
What to Serve with This Recipe
Suggested Pairings
This zucchini bread stands deliciously on its own—but if you want to dress it up a bit or serve it as part of a spread, here are a few perfect pairings:
-
Hot drinks: A warm slice with a cup of coffee, spiced chai, or a cozy mug of earl grey is pure heaven.
-
Desserts: Add a scoop of vanilla ice cream, a dollop of whipped cream, or even a spoonful of mascarpone.
-
Toppings: A light drizzle of honey, a slather of cream cheese, or a zesty lemon glaze all add something special.
-
Sides: Pair with fresh berries, citrus salad, or sliced apples for a refreshing contrast.
Variations and Substitutions
Nut-Free Option
No nuts? No problem!
-
Simply leave them out, or replace them with something equally crunchy like sunflower seeds or shredded coconut.
Extra Chocolatey
For the chocoholics (we see you):
-
Double the chocolate chips.
-
Swirl in a few tablespoons of Nutella.
-
Add 1 tablespoon of cocoa powder to the dry mix for a deep chocolate twist.
Gluten-Free Version
Yes, you can absolutely make this gluten-free.
-
Use a 1:1 gluten-free baking flour blend in place of both flours.
-
Add an extra egg to help with structure and hold.
-
Bonus: Let the batter sit for 10–15 minutes before baking to hydrate the GF flour.
Vegan Option
Want to skip the eggs and dairy? This recipe adapts beautifully:
-
Replace eggs with flax eggs (1 tbsp ground flax + 3 tbsp water per egg).
-
Use applesauce or mashed banana in place of the oil for a lower-fat version.
-
Opt for vegan chocolate chips and skip the dairy altogether.
Storage Instructions
Room Temperature
One of the best things about this zucchini bread (aside from the flavor!) is how well it stores.
-
Keep it in an airtight container at room temperature for up to 3 days.
-
Pro tip? It’s often even better the next day—the flavors continue to meld and the crumb gets even more tender.
Refrigeration Tips
If you want to stretch it a little longer:
-
Wrap the loaf (or individual slices) tightly in plastic wrap, then place in a sealed container.
-
It’ll stay fresh and moist in the fridge for up to 1 week.
Freezing Instructions
Zucchini bread is a freezer-friendly dream.
-
Wrap slices individually in plastic wrap or parchment.
-
Store them in a freezer-safe bag or container for up to 3 months.
-
When you’re ready to enjoy, thaw at room temperature or pop into the microwave for 30 seconds for a warm, just-baked feel.
Recipe Tips and Tricks
Whether it’s your first loaf or your fiftieth, these little tips make all the difference:
- Squeeze the zucchini well – This is the golden rule. Too much moisture = soggy bread.
- Don’t overmix – Stir just until combined to keep the texture tender and fluffy.
- Use good cinnamon and vanilla – These cozy flavors really shine here.
- Check for doneness at 50 minutes – Ovens vary, so don’t skip the toothpick test.
- Cool completely before slicing – It’ll be easier to cut and the flavor develops as it rests.
Related Recipes
If you loved this zucchini bread recipe, you might also enjoy these delicious creations from Creative’s Cookery:
-
Marbled Banana Bread: Swirled with chocolate and banana, this bread is a visual and flavorful treat.
-
Banana Blondies Recipe: A gooey, banana-packed blondie bar that’s perfect for snacking.
-
Banana Pancake Recipe for Baby: Soft, simple, and ideal for little tummies.
-
Banana Protein Smoothie Recipe: A post-bake healthy protein boost to pair with your bread.
-
Easy Homemade Naan Bread: If you love baking bread, try this soft, fluffy side dish too.
FAQs
Can I make zucchini bread without eggs?
Yes! You can use flax eggs (1 tbsp flaxseed meal + 3 tbsp water per egg) or unsweetened applesauce as a substitute.
Why is my zucchini bread soggy in the middle?
Most likely, the zucchini still had too much water. Make sure to squeeze it out well with a clean kitchen towel or paper towels.
Can I use yellow squash instead?
Definitely! Yellow squash has a very similar texture and mild flavor—it works just as well.
Can I make muffins instead of bread?
Absolutely. Pour the batter into a lined muffin tin and bake at 350°F for 18–22 minutes.
Do I need to peel the zucchini?
Nope! The peel is thin, tender, and full of nutrients. It melts right into the bread and gives lovely little green flecks.
Is this zucchini bread healthy?
It can be! It’s already lighter than many desserts, and you can make it even healthier by reducing the sugar, using whole wheat flour, or swapping in coconut oil.
Conclusion
This zucchini bread is everything you want in a homemade bake—moist, flavorful, and wonderfully simple. Whether you’re baking to use up summer squash or just craving a cozy loaf to share with loved ones, this recipe has you covered.
It’s flexible enough to fit your pantry, easy enough for beginners, and tasty enough that it rarely lasts more than a day or two.
PrintMoist Zucchini Bread Recipe
- Total Time: 1 hour 10 minutes
- Yield: 10 slices 1x
- Diet: Vegetarian
Description
A moist and lightly spiced zucchini bread made with grated zucchini, whole wheat flour, and optional nuts or chocolate chips.
Ingredients
- 2 cups grated zucchini (about 2 medium zucchinis)
- 1 ½ cups all-purpose flour
- ½ cup whole wheat flour
- 1 tsp baking powder
- ½ tsp baking soda
- ½ tsp salt
- 2 tsp ground cinnamon
- ½ tsp ground nutmeg
- 2 large eggs
- ½ cup olive oil (or melted coconut oil)
- ¾ cup cane sugar (or brown sugar)
- 1 tsp vanilla extract
- ½ cup chopped walnuts or pecans (optional)
- ½ cup dark chocolate chips (optional)
Instructions
- Preheat oven to 350°F (175°C). Grease a 9×5-inch loaf pan and line with parchment paper.
- Grate zucchini and squeeze out excess moisture.
- In a medium bowl, whisk together dry ingredients.
- In a large bowl, whisk eggs, oil, sugar, and vanilla.
- Fold in the grated zucchini.
- Add dry ingredients into the wet mixture until just combined.
- Fold in nuts and/or chocolate chips if using.
- Pour batter into loaf pan and smooth the top.
- Bake for 50–60 minutes or until a toothpick comes out clean.
- Cool in pan for 10 minutes, then transfer to a wire rack.
Notes
- Use fresh zucchini with skin on for best texture.
- Don’t overmix the batter to keep the bread moist.
- Store in an airtight container for up to 3 days or freeze slices.
- Prep Time: 15 minutes
- Cook Time: 55 minutes
- Category: Baking
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 slice
- Calories: 235
- Sugar: 14g
- Sodium: 160mg
- Fat: 11g
- Saturated Fat: 2g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 29g
- Fiber: 2g
- Protein: 4g
- Cholesterol: 35mg
Keywords: zucchini bread, healthy zucchini bread, easy zucchini loaf, chocolate zucchini bread